Description:
A licensed Realtor® with The Stone Co., Mila is best known as the listing agent for Mint Condition Homes - an Oakland redevelopment company that specializes in transforming distressed and foreclosed properties with green design sensibilities and an eye towards the building era in which each home was built. In addition to her real estate license (DRE #01857142), Mila is an Associate Member of the American Institute of Architects, an EPA Certified Home Renovator, and a Certified Green Building Professional. Her work with Mint Condition Homes has received two "Partners In Preservation" Awards from the Oakland Heritage Alliance and was named Build It Green's member elected "Green Building Champion of 2010".
